Rising Action Theatre presents the South Florida Premiere of the Tony Award-winning Grey Gardens, the Musical. Based on the highly acclaimed 1975 Maysles Brothers film documentary, it is the story of Jackie Kennedy's relatives "Big Edie" Bouvier Beale and her adult daughter "Little Edie" and the overgrown, crumbling East Hampton mansion they shared for decades. Set at the Grey Gardens mansion, the musical follows the progression of the lives of the two Edies from their original social status as wealthy and polished aristocrats in the 1940's to their eventual existence as penniless eccentrics in a crumbling home. But, the real focus is clearly on the unending psychological struggle between a mother and a daughter. The story is joyous, heartwarming, sad, and funny.

Under the direction of Kevin Coughlin ("Reefer Madness", "Flora the Red Menace") with choreography by Dave Campbell ("Andrews Brothers", "Reefer Madness", Canadian Idol), Grey Gardens, the Musical features an outstanding cast of South Florida actors. Dee Deringer-Piquette and Erin Pittleman make their Rising Action debuts as Big Edie and Little Edie. They are supported by Rising Action veterans Larry Buzzeo, Joseph Long and Christopher Michaels, and newcomers Lisa Kerstin Braun, Katie Harmon, Skylar Voelker and Jerry Weinberg.

Grey Gardens, the Musical has a book by Doug Wright, Lyrics by Michael Korie and Music by Scott Frankel. It played over 300 performances on Broadway in 2006-2007, was nominated for ten Tony Awards (including Best Musical) and won three. Grey Gardens was also recently adapted into an award-winning HBO non-musical drama featuring Jessica Lange and Drew Barrymore.
